Krea is a comprehensive, powerful creative AI suite designed to generate, edit, and enhance images, videos, and 3D assets. It provides professionals and beginners alike with access to a wide array of state-of-the-art AI models within a single, unified workspace. Created to streamline complex creative workflows, Krea eliminates the need to subscribe to multiple different services, offering instead a central hub for generative design, professional-grade upscaling, and advanced video creation. Whether users are working on architectural visualizations, product photography, or social media content, Krea provides the necessary tools to iterate rapidly and achieve high-quality results. The platform includes a user-friendly interface that requires minimal training, allowing users to focus on their creative vision rather than technical hurdles. Behind the scenes, Krea leverages a sophisticated infrastructure to provide industry-leading inference speeds and robust support for both individual and enterprise users. The platform supports advanced features like LoRA fine-tuning, which enables creators to train custom models on specific brand styles or characters, ensuring consistent output for professional projects. Furthermore, Krea emphasizes real-time interaction, offering tools that turn basic primitives into photorealistic renders in milliseconds, thereby accelerating the conceptual phase of any creative project.

Some of the key features are:

  • Multi-Model Access: Instant access to over 50 leading AI models, including Krea 2, Flux, Veo 3.1, Sora 2, Kling, and Imagen 4.
  • High-Fidelity Upscaling: Advanced upscaling capabilities supporting resolutions up to 22K, incorporating models like Topaz for superior clarity.
  • Real-time Rendering: An intuitive canvas that renders photorealistic images from primitive shapes in under 50ms.
  • Custom Model Training: Professional LoRA fine-tuning capabilities that allow users to teach the AI specific faces, products, or unique visual styles.
  • Node-Based Workflows: A visual, no-code editor that enables users to chain different models and tasks together into automated production pipelines.
  • Video Generation & Enhancement: Comprehensive video tools for text-to-video, image-to-video, frame interpolation, and professional-grade video style transfer.
  • Asset Management: A built-in asset manager designed to keep creative projects organized and accessible across the team.
  • Enterprise Integration: Robust admin tools, including SSO, team-wide project sharing, audit logs, and per-user spending limits, to manage large-scale creative operations.

Users typically interact with Krea through its web-based app, which offers a clean, minimalist UI that emphasizes speed and ease of use. Designers can start from text prompts, upload reference images, or use real-time tools to sketch out compositions. The platform handles the underlying technical complexities, allowing users to seamlessly transition from generation to editing, upscaling, and final export. For developers or teams seeking deeper integration, Krea also provides a REST API that allows programmatic access to its suite of generative tools.

Some common use cases include:

  • Marketing & Advertising: Generating professional product photography and campaign assets at scale without the need for traditional photoshoots.
  • Architectural Visualization: Quickly creating high-quality architectural renders and interior design concepts from simple floor plans or sketches.
  • Creative Agencies: Maintaining brand consistency across diverse projects by training and utilizing custom LoRA models specific to a client's brand identity.
  • Social Media Production: Rapidly producing engaging video content, removing backgrounds, and upscaling assets for high-resolution displays.
  • Gaming & 3D Development: Generating textures, character concepts, and 3D assets that can be further refined within existing production pipelines.
